Understand the Community Standards

Each subreddit on Reddit has its own distinct culture and set of rules, which often includes guidelines about sharing links. Before posting anything, take the time to read the subreddit's rules. Some subreddits may discourage self-promotion outright, while others may be more lenient, as long as the link is relevant and adds value to the discussion.

Balance Self-Promotion with Contribution

Reddit values authentic engagement over blatant self-promotion. A common guideline is the 9:1 rule, suggesting that only 1 out of every 10 of your posts should be self-promotional. This doesn't mean you should spam nine random posts just to share your link - instead, engage meaningfully with the community. Comment on other people's posts, share interesting content unrelated to your business, and become an active, respected member of the community.

The Art of Dropping Links

Your post's body is usually not the best place for your link, as self-promotional posts are more likely to get removed. Comments, on the other hand, are usually a safer place. Wait until your post gains traction, then add a comment with further information and a link to your website. This also creates an opportunity for you to engage with the community in the comments section. Your Reddit bio is another potential spot to include your link. People often check the profile of users who post interesting content or insightful comments. Making sure your bio is engaging and includes a link to your website could generate more traffic.

Understand the SEO Value of Reddit Links

While Reddit links are "nofollow" links, meaning they don't directly contribute to your site's SEO ranking, they can still generate substantial referral traffic and indirectly boost your SEO. High engagement on your Reddit post can make it rank on search engine results, which means more visibility for your link. Moreover, other sites may find your content through Reddit and link to it, creating valuable "dofollow" backlinks.
